Centennial A.M.E. Zion Church
“A Church with a Heart to Serve the Community for Christ.”
127–125 Doat Street • Buffalo, New York 14211 - Approved Local Landmark Historic Designation #167
Purpose: To worship God, serve people, and inspire hope while building a sustainable legacy that transforms families and strengthens our community through faith, love, and service.
Mission:
We equip, evangelize, and engage people through authentic worship, faith, and community partnerships - empowering individuals and families to grow, serve, and become impactful disciples of Jesus Christ.
(Matthew 28:18–20)
Vision: To be a Spirit-led church and community resource center that nurtures faith, develops future leaders, restores families, and transforms our neighborhood into a healthier, stronger, and hope-filled community for generations to come.
Centennial Core Focus: Equip - Evangelize - Empower - Emerge: Equip: Strengthening people through faith, biblical teaching, and life development.
Evangelize: Sharing Christ with love, authenticity, and community connection.
Empower: Providing resources and support so people can overcome barriers and grow.
Emerge: Building a sustainable future through innovation, community partnerships, and neighborhood transformation.
Community Commitment Statement: Centennial AME Zion Church is a historic sacred place of worship, refuge, and community transformation hub where faith, youth, family, and resources come together to inspire hope, develop leaders, and create a sustainable legacy of service for Buffalo and beyond. |
